🎓 Education Background

Dr. Yang Liu pursued his academic journey in the field of chemistry, specializing in organic synthesis and materials chemistry. He earned his Ph.D. in Organic Chemistry from Wuhan University (2007-2010), one of China’s top institutions known for its excellence in scientific research. Prior to that, he completed his M.S. in Pesticide Science at Huazhong Normal University (2004-2007), where he developed expertise in chemical applications for agriculture and materials science. His strong educational foundation has equipped him with the skills to advance research in organic synthesis and material chemistry.
